Ladies and Gentlemen, Nightcrawler Tactical's latest item is sure to spark the interest of film and television fans everywhere. We're proud to introduce the Point-Click(tm)!

What happened the last time you had to draw down on a badguy? Had your snappy comeback or witty pun all ready to go, right? Pointed your sidearm and what? Silence? Perhaps a weak-sounding click of a safety being disabled?

Tired of real-world firearms mechanics ruining the drama of your two-fisted fight for justice? Then the revolutionary Point-Click(tm) is for you!

Using a patented design, the Point-Click(tm) consists of a set of special grips, versions of which are available for most popular models of revolvers and semiautomatics. Slip-on models are available for polymer framed guns, especially drama-ruining hammerless designs like the Glock and XD.

When properly installed, the Point-Click(tm) controls are simple. You have a small lever on the front strap of the grip. All you have to do is squeeze firmly with your non-trigger fingers, and you'll get a loud metallic click-CLICK sound from your weapon. At additional cost, you can get the deluxe Point-Click(tm), offering click-click-CLICK sounds, or the traditional click-click-CLACK-click of the original Single Action Army revolver.

From now on, you can strike fear into the hearts of your enemies, by having the terrifying hammer-cocking sound available each time you point your weapon, regardless of whether your weapon even has a hammer!

Act now and get a second Point-Click(tm) absolutely free!

Coming soon! Point-Click(tm) models for rifles and shotguns, that will deliver an intimidating KERCHACK! sound, even if you already have a round chambered, or are carrying a single-shot weapon!
